Integrated Technology Partners (ITP) is a privately held, St. Louis based, ERP consulting organization. Through our dedication, industry expertise, creativity and perseverance, our consulting firm offers a unique experience for your organization to navigate the requirements of modern business practi...See more
Headquarters:
United States of America
Company Type:
SME
Company size:
11-50 Employees
Year Founded:
1997 (29 years)
Address:
null
LOW
spending power